Output 650921d085472ceb92d294b0b7c0201f81116151723aea40c22e82d1b11de315: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 886ee73e86491e83ac755fb6df666a62a1b3eb0f OP_EQUALVERIFY OP_CHECKSIG
address
1DSPknYGmBYt7xbQWe6L1yswWbjJyKtWEy
transaction
650921d085472ceb92d294b0b7c0201f81116151723aea40c22e82d1b11de315
spent
true